WebNo, gophers do not eat daffodils. This is because daffodils are poisonous due to a toxic element contained in the whole plant called lycorine. WebApr 13, 2024 · What do gophers eat? Gophers are herbivores. They like to eat the roots, bulbs and tubers of plants along with the leaves. Often, a gopher will find the root of a plant growing in its tunnel and pull the plant down to eat it. ... They include daffodils, geraniums, iris, sage, and thyme.
